## Deploying the new reset flow

Heads up: the Wrenfield password reset flow got a full revamp in this release. Reset tokens are now single-use and scoped per device, so any plugin that cached the old token format will need a small update — check the hooks doc. Deployment is otherwise the usual `wrenfield deploy` dance, no schema changes. Before shipping, make sure the reset service picks up the configuration shown here.

settings of tagef-bawif:
DRUIX_HOST=druix.zemvarlabs.internal
DRUIX_PORT=8000

## Authentication

The Fernpad wiki uses role-based access: readers, editors, and stewards. Contractors start as editors scoped to their assigned space. All API calls go through the Gatehouse proxy, which maps your role to permitted endpoints. Sessions expire after twelve hours. For local development against the staging wiki, authenticate using the key below.

app token of bawep-hafog = kto7_vwrmnlx

Subject: Retirement of the Osprey Line

Exec team — decision confirmed: the Osprey product line retires end of Q2. No new orders after March. Finance to model write-downs on remaining Osprey inventory at the Trevano warehouse and wind down supplier commitments with Kellridge Components. Support obligations run twelve months post-sale. Figures due by Friday. Forward direction is summarised in the confidential note below.

internal memo for kaguf-yajog: Headcount on the Druath team goes from 30 to 70 by the end of November. Gross margin on Druath came in at 56 percent against a plan of 28 percent.

**Vendor note: Inkmill markdown pipeline**

Rendering for Parchway docs is outsourced to Inkmill under an annual contract, renewing each March. They handle sanitization and PDF export; we own the upload queue. SLA: 4-hour response on rendering failures. Escalate only after two failed retries. Their support desk is reachable at the address below.

billing contact of hahaf-baguf = zorael.tammir.jorius@sivrelhq.internal

Subject: Tax cache cut-over done

Cut-over of the Pennywhistle tax-rate lookup cache completed at 02:10. Old in-process cache is disabled; all lookups now hit the shared Copperline cache tier. TTL dropped from 24h to 1h per finance's request. If rates look stale, purge the keyspace and restart the worker pool — runbook has steps. The cache tier is running with the following configuration:

deployment values, kajep-kageg:
[praix]
host = praix.paliqcorp.corp
user = praix_svc
database = praix_prod